Cockroaches and Fall in Tempe:

Cockroaches are a year-round problem in Arizona, but they become particularly active during the fall. As temperatures start to drop, these resilient insects seek shelter, warmth, and food sources. Your cozy home becomes an ideal refuge for cockroaches, and they will stop at nothing to infiltrate your space.

Health Risks:

Cockroaches are more than just a nuisance; they can also present significant health risks to you and your family. These pests are known carriers of bacteria, parasites, and allergens. Here are some health concerns associated with cockroach infestations:

a. Allergies: Cockroach droppings and shed skin contain allergens that can trigger asthma and allergic reactions in sensitive individuals.

b. Disease Transmission: Cockroaches can transmit diseases such as salmonella, E. coli, and other harmful bacteria by contaminating food and surfaces in your home.

c. Respiratory Issues: Exposure to cockroach allergens can exacerbate respiratory issues, especially in children and the elderly.

Property Damage:

Cockroaches are not only a threat to your health but also to your home. They are known for their gnawing and destructive behavior, causing damage to various household items, including electrical wiring and paper products. Their feces can stain and damage surfaces, and the unpleasant odor they produce can permeate your living spaces.

Prevention Tips:

Preventing a cockroach infestation during the fall in Tempe is crucial. Here are some tips to keep these pests at bay:

a. Seal Entry Points: Inspect your home for any cracks, gaps, or openings and seal them to prevent cockroaches from getting inside.

b. Keep a Clean Home: Cockroaches are attracted to food sources, so maintain a clean and tidy environment, especially the kitchen.

c. Fix Leaks: Cockroaches are also drawn to water sources, so repair any leaky pipes and keep your home dry.
